PRIVATE PEACEFUL

Private Peaceful, a new play adapted and directed by Simon Reade, from the award-winning young adult novel by Michael Morpurgo (War Horse), recently completed a US tour following its celebrated New York premiere. 

The critically acclaimed one-man show stars Shane O’Regan, who also toured throughout Ireland in the production. O’Regan plays more than 24 characters in what has hailed as a tour de force performance.

Private Peaceful is a timely reminder of the heroic sacrifices that were made by the soldiers in World War I. The production comes to New York in the centenary year of the end of World War I. The story follows the life of a young soldier, Thomas ‘Tommo’ Peaceful (Shane O’Regan), facing the firing squad for cowardice. As Tommo sits in his cell awaiting sunrise, he thinks back on the events that made him the person he is today. Tommo recounts memories of growing up with his elder brother, Charlie.
